We stopped at this park on the last leg of our Gaspésie tour. We used the road that takes you pretty much at the top of the mount, where you will find a large parking lot to park. Then it's a couple minutes of walk to get to the belvedere and church that sits at the top of the mountain. You will also find a visitor center building and washrooms there. The view from there is quite spectacular, giving you an overall view of the Baie des Chaleurs. The church is more of a contemporary style and offers a beautiful mosaic in its altar. We took a trail down the mountain around the church which was actually a mountain bike trail, so not the best when you're walking/hiking (see map). A nice place to stop to enjoy the view of the area that is quite magnificent.

Stayed in the GeoDomes September 19 and 20. What an amazing experience! The gentleman that checked us in was great, and the other staff was alway helpful and accomadating. The domes are very well equipped with everything you need for cooking. Make sure you bring your own coffee we forgot ours! Great BBQ, nice small fridge, and toaster oven. The view is incredible, then after dark it just as amazing again. You can spend hours just sitting enjoying the view.

Must visit place,beautiful view on the top of the mountain. Just one tip for those new visitors. On your way back driving down the mountain, be careful not to brake all the time. because it might cause the brakes overheat and get serious damage. Thanks to the friendly local bikers reminding me. Great place and great people. Love it❤️
